Netflix has placed a straight to series, 13-episode order of new comedy show Grace and Frankie, which will star Jane Fonda and Lily Tomlin. The half hour-long, single camera episodes will help flesh out the online streaming subscription service’s originals line-up, joining the likes of Arrested Development, House of Cards and Orange is the New Black.

Set to premiere in summer 2015, the show will reunite the stars of the 1980 feature hit 9 to 5 who will play two longtime rivals who are brought together when their husbands decide to run off together to get married. “The women find their lives both turned upside down and to their dismay, permanently intertwined. Eventually, to their surprise, they find they have each other,” states Netflix, via LA Times.

“Jane Fonda and Lily Tomlin are among the funniest and most formidable actresses ever and it’s an incredible privilege to give them the opportunity to run riot on Netflix,” Netflix chief content officer Ted Sarandos said, announcing the order. “The show created for them by Marta and Howard is warm, very funny and anything but wholesome. We can’t wait.”

Grace and Frankie has been created by Friends co-creator Marta Kauffman and Howard J. Morris (‘Sullivan & Son’) with Paula Weinstein and David Ellison producing and Fonda, Tomlin, Dana Goldberg and Marcy Ross exec producing.

There are high hopes for Grace and Frankie and it looks like TV show veterans Fonda (‘The Newsroom’) and Tomlin (‘Web Therapy’) will be able to pull things off come mid-2015. With two Oscar wins and another nomination between them, both actresses are hard-working, talented and popular enough to see the show to success.

Grace and Frankie will be vital in helping Netflix expand its original series arsenal, which includes five series currently in development: Sense8, an untitled Todd A. Kessler/ Daniel Zelman/Glenn Kessler project, Marco Polo, Grace And Frankie and a final season of The Killing.
